Looks like Merge Trade Customer Service…

Looks like Merge Trade Customer Service Live Chat that used to be so instant, has gone completely dumb. I made a first withdrawal of $500 out of a total balance of $1081 accumulated over 2 months of profits reinvesting. They claimed they have an automated withdrawal processing which according to my experience did not turn out to be the case. I have not received my funds for over 24 hours since I made the withdrawal.

I made a first withdrawal which was cancelled without any explanation. Thinking it could be a technical problem, I went ahead and made a second withdrawal which like the first, was cancelled and have the funds returned to my balance. As I said, the Live Chat did not reply to my inquiries and so I decided to reach Merge Trade through WhatsApp. We exchanged 3 messages in total with the last one saying this to me:
‘Please kindly exercise patience, I have already informed the management
They will look into your account.

I will also look into your account once am less busy‘.

Once am less busy? It’s been over 12 hours since I received that reply message, and the agent is still busy not to be able to come back to me to tell me anything regarding my blocked payment. I’m sorry to say this, but it looks like something is not adding up.

I hope they will reflect on their glorious promises including the assurance of operating a legit business, and attend to me. I hesitate to use the “Scam” word for now, which I will in my subsequent review post if they fail to mend their act and do the right thing by releasing my funds. Thank you 🙏.
